Hypertension? Try Hibiscus Tea
http://health.webmd.com/cgi-bin21/DM/y/e3Xj0NedAu0F60BYQy0EI
If you're looking for a way to lower your blood pressure, it may be
time for tea -- hibiscus tea, that is. A new study showed that
drinking three cups a day reduced hypertension.
